Summary

Function: llRemoveInventory( string item );

Remove the named inventory item

• string item an item in the inventory of the prim this script is in

Caveats

  • If item is missing from the prim's inventory then an error is shouted on DEBUG_CHANNEL.
  • If the current script is removed it will continue to run for a short period of time after this call.
  • With multiple executions an llSleep(0.1) after llRemoveInventory will allow edit window contents to refresh correctly and avoid errors on phantom contents.
  • llRemoveInventory will not trigger a changed event.

Examples

// Remove the current script from the object

default
{
    state_entry()
    {
        llRemoveInventory(llGetScriptName());
    }
}
// user-function to include in your script
// deletes all other contents of any type except the script itself
delete_all_other_contents()
{
    string thisScript = llGetScriptName();
    string inventoryItemName;

    integer index = llGetInventoryNumber(INVENTORY_ALL);
    while (index)
    {
        --index;        // (faster than index--;)

        inventoryItemName = llGetInventoryName(INVENTORY_ALL, index);

        if (inventoryItemName != thisScript)   
            llRemoveInventory(inventoryItemName);     
    }
}

default
{
    state_entry()
    {
        delete_all_other_contents();
    }
}
